Cache Valley Routing Number

Cache Valley Routing Numbers

No. Routing Number Address City State
1 124084779 101 N. Main Logan UT (Utah)
2 124302325 101 N. Main Logan UT (Utah)
3 124302930 101 North Main Street Logan UT (Utah)
4 124303023 101 North Main Logan UT (Utah)
5 124303049 101 N Main Logan UT (Utah)

Where to Find the Routing Number of Cache Valley Bank on the Cheque?

You might wonder how to find the Cache Valley routing number on the cheque. It is very quick and easy. You will find the Cache Valley 9-digit routing number printed on the left-hand corner at the bottom of your cheque. Don’t get confused between the Cache Valley routing number and the account number. The Cache Valley Bank routing number is simply comprised of nine digits. In the middle, you will see the Your Cache Valley Bank account number and check number at the end.
